Identifying Problem Areas

It’s crucial to identify all sharp corners in your home first. Start with low furniture pieces like coffee tables, TV stands, and dining tables. Don’t forget kitchen counters and any room with built-in shelves. Having a taller child? Look for corners at their eye level too. I found out the hard way – our bookshelf’s bottom edge was perfect for my daughter’s forehead. A thorough inspection helps you catch those hidden hazards.

Choosing the Right Safety Products

Now that you’ve spotted the danger zones, it’s time to pick safety products. Corner guards come in all materials: foam, rubber, plastic, even silicone. Try to match them with your home decor for minimal disruption. Adhesive types are easy to apply and remove. I swear by the cushioned foam guards for the table in the playroom. Just peel, stick, and breathe a sigh of relief. Research reviews and ask fellow parents for recommendations.

DIY Corner Guard Solutions

Feeling crafty? DIY corner guards can be both fun and budget-friendly. Pool noodles or pipe insulation make excellent corner protectors. Measure the corners, cut the noodle, and attach with double-sided tape. It’s a personal touch to childproofing your home. And the best part? They come in funky colors. One Sunday afternoon project later, you’ll have safer living spaces and a prouder parent heart.
